1. 定义函数:函数名为fun41,输入一个变量x,输出变量y,其中y=sqrt(x) * log(x)。
  2. 使用复合梯形公式和复合辛普森公式计算数值积分:
  • 定义步长h,将其分为n个小步长。
  • 对于复合梯形公式,初始化t=0,通过循环累加fun41函数在每个小步长上的值,最后根据公式计算积分值T。
  • 对于复合辛普森公式,初始化s1和s2为0,通过两个循环分别计算fun41函数在每个小步长上的值,最后根据公式计算积分值S。
  1. 使用龙贝格算法计算数值积分:
  • 初始化m=16,h=1,计算T表的第一项。
  • 循环迭代计算T表的对角线上的元素,每次将h减半,计算新的积分值t,并根据梯形公式计算出新的T表项。
  • 对T表进行迭代,不断更新T表的对角线上的元素,最终得到积分值。
逐行分析下列代码1 定义函数function y=fun41xy=sqrtxlogx;2 用复合梯形公式和复合辛普森公式计算数值积分clear;clc;h=0001; h为步长可分别令h=1010010001n=1h; t=0; for i=1n-1 t=t+fun41ih;endT=h20+2t+fun411;T=vpaT10 以上为复合梯形公式 以下为复合辛普森公式s1=0;s

原文地址: https://www.cveoy.top/t/topic/e4Cy 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录